Climate overview of Virsac

Temperatures in Virsac, Aquitaine, France, vary greatly throughout the year. August is the hottest month at 28°C (82°F), while January is the coldest at 11°C (52°F).

Annual rainfall is moderate at around 808 mm (32 in), with November being the wettest month. The city also has warm summers and cold winters. Sunshine peaks in July, when the city sees around 8.3 hours of sunshine per day.

Monthly Temperature in Virsac

The climate in Virsac is known for significant temperature differences throughout the year, making the weather dynamic. Average daytime temperatures reach a comfortable 28°C (82°F) in August. In January, the coolest month of the year, temperatures drop to a chilly 11°C (52°F).

At night, temperatures range from around 16°C (61°F) in August to 3°C (37°F) in January.

Rainfall in Virsac

Generally, Virsac receives mid-range precipitation levels, with 808 mm (32 in) annually. Despite minor fluctuations, Virsac enjoys fairly consistent precipitation throughout the year. In November, you can expect around 82 mm (3.2 in) of precipitation, while in July, Virsac receives about 50 mm (2 in). For more details, please visit our Virsac Precipitation page.

Sunshine Hours in Virsac

Virsac can be enjoyed more throughout the sunniest month of July under a blue sky, with approximately 8.3 hours of sunshine daily. In contrast, the city experiences much darker days in December, with only 2.8 hours of sunlight per day.

Best Time to Visit Virsac

Conditions in Virsac are generally most comfortable in May, June, July, August, September and October. They are typically least comfortable in January, February and December.

Monthly ratings reflect general weather comfort, based on daytime temperature and rainfall. Swimming and winter conditions are highlighted separately where relevant.

  • Best overall: May, June, July, August, September and October
  • Warmest weather: July and August
  • Most sunshine: June, July and August
  • Fewest rainy days: June, July, August and September
  • Seasonal pattern: Warm summers and cold winters

How sunny is Virsac?

Virsac receives around 2,040 hours of sunshine per year. July is the sunniest month with 249 hours, while December is the cloudiest with just 83 hours. Overall, Virsac enjoys abundant sunshine.
